Transaction 8320489bf74c976b086ae504f7d84c97425e4645bf404f475a26ff5937098aa2

52 Input
2 Outputs
  • 8320489bf74c976b086ae504f7d84c97425e4645bf404f475a26ff5937098aa2:0
  • value  3148631
    address  1MoRvtyQzTfhCfbGiHRaf7Z3fzHEZTtGbz
  • 8320489bf74c976b086ae504f7d84c97425e4645bf404f475a26ff5937098aa2:1
  • value  10903262
    address  3MFPpTKFkmBVmi4BFJyxGu5RU4jmN3Leqa